  • The purpose of the present study is to investigate the influence of seasonal temperature variation on the thermal stresses in roller compacted concrete dam(RCD) structures. Using the finite element code, DIANA performs 2-D transient temperature and resultant stress analysis for RCD. Time variability of the mesh geometry is considered in order to simulate successive phases of the structure's construction. The main analysis variables are construction sequence, concrete temperature and ambient temperature. The results show principal tensile stress of hot-weathering concrete is higher than that of cold-weathering concrete. In some case the index of thermal cracking excesses 1.0, RCD also needs thermal management on placing temperature according to weather condition.

  • In this study, experimental research was carried out to investigate the seismic and structural performance of precast concrete exterior beam-column joints using bolt type connection and prestressing method. A total of five full-scale exterior beam-column joints were constructed and tested under reversed cyclic loading, controlled by displacement. Results of the test are as follows: Energy dissipation capacity and pinching phenomenon of PC beam-column joints showed disadvantageous behavior compared to RC beam-column joints. However, drift capacity of the PC joint was excellent. Also, yield mechanism concentrated on embedded nuts was suitable as an exterior beam-column joint of lateral load resistance frame. Additional application of prestressing method was also very effective to control excessive pinching and cracking in the joint region, and thus improved an overall seismic performance of the PC joint.

  • Recently, the external prestressing method is being much frequently used in strengthening reinforced concrete structures because of it's excellent load resistance and serviceability increases comparing to other strengthening methods. However, it is true that the research on fatigue performance of concrete structures strengthened by the external prestressing using FRP tendons is rare. Therefore, the purpose of this study is to evaluate the safety and feasibility of the external prestressing method by analyzing the characteristics of the reinforced concrete beam strengthening using FRP tendons under repeated loads. Test variables adopted in this experimental study are the types of external prestressing material (steel or FRP tendon) and the repeated load ranges. The repeated load range have the minimum 50% of yield load of reinforced concrete beam and the maximum 70-85%. The test beams are loaded by 4 point loadings with 3 Hz sine wave. From this experimental study, it is confirmed that the reinforced concrete beams strengthened using FRP tendons have sufficient safety against fatigue, especially in FRP tendon itself, tendon at deviators and tendon at anchorages.

  • This study was conducted to evaluate the feasibility of expedite repairing of concrete pavements using precast concrete pavement method and to investigate the effectiveness of slab connection methods. In the demonstration construction, four slabs of jointed concrete pavements were replaced with the precast slabs. First, precast concrete slabs were designed and fabricated, then existing slabs were cut and removed, and finally precast slabs were installed. The slabs were leveled and pockets, holes, and space between the slab bottom and the underlying layer were grouted. From the demonstration construction, details about the design and construction of the precast pavements for repairing of pavements were evaluated. In addition, the slab connection methods such as pocket and hole connection methods were applied in the construction and the slab curling behaviors at the joints that include those connection methods were compared. The results showed that both slab connection methods were applicable, and the hole connection method was superior.

  • This paper outlines a new strengthening technique for concrete beams using externally unbended high-strength bars. The advantages of proposed method lie in speed and simplicity of construction compared to the alternative strengthening method. Externally unbended reinforcement retains many of the advantages over external unbended prestressed tendons. It eliminates time consuming stressing operations. Clearance requirements around anchorages are reduced as access is not required for prestressing jacks. Test results of eight specimens on reinforced concrete beams using different reinforcement materials such as carbon fiber sheet, steel plate and high-tension bar are reported. The beam strengthened by carbon fiber sheet showed a brittle failure mode due to the separation of fiber. As a result of draped profile of external bar, the maximum strength of the beam were increased by up to 212 percent and the deflections were reduced by up to 65 percent. Test results show that the beams reinforced with high-tension bar are superior to reference specimens, especially for the strength and deformation capacity.

  • 교통량이 많은 도심지내 장대 지하차도 건설은 교통정체 해소에 기여를 하지만 초기 공사비가 많이 소요되는 단점이 있다. 또한, 화재등 유고시 이용자의 안전을 최우선으로 고려되어야 한다. 즉, 장대 지하차도 건설에 있어서 경제성과 안전성이 함께 만족할 수 있는 건설 방안이 필요하다. 세종지하차도는 이러한 문제점을 극복하고자 다음과 같이 지하차도의 환기방식 및 단면, 포장형식, 사고 예방 및 발생시를 대비한 종합방재시스템을 구축하였다. $\cdot$환기방식은 종류식 환기방식의 경제성과 횡류식 환기방식의 제연성능을 겸비할 수 있는 조합형 환기방식과 Duct Arch 단면을 적용하여 공사비 절감 및 운영시 유지관리비를 획기적으로 절감하였다. $\cdot$지하차도 포장형식은 화재시 내화성이 우수하며 유독가스 발생이 없는 HPC(고성능 콘크리트 포장) 포장을 적용하여 이용자의 안전을 최우선으로 고려하였고 일반 아스팔트 포장 및 배수성 아스팔트 포장에 비해 우수한 성능과 공용수명을 가진 공법을 적용함으로서 유지보수비용의 절감을 가능하게 하였다. 또한, 콘크리트포장의 단점인 소음발생을 최소화하기 위해 타이닝과 그루빙을 적용하였다. $\cdot$지하차도내 화재 등 유고시 신속한 대피가 가능하도록 피난 연락문 간격을 167m 간격으로 설치하고 비상탈출계단 6개소를 확보하였다. 또한 노약자 및 환자의 지하차도 외부로 대피를 돕기 위해 비상엘리베이터 3개소를 설치하는 등 사고발생 시 종합적으로 대처할 수 있는 시스템을 마련하여 적용하였다.

  • In the present study, hollow precast concrete wall (PC Double Wall) for staircase construction was developed. Comparing the conventional walls, the PC Double Wall can be reduced the lift weight using hollow core and improves the integrity between the PC members. The cross-section and re-bar details of the PC Double Wall were developed considering precast concrete manufacturing, constructability, and the structural safety. Particularly, a form system was developed to manufacture thin and hollow core PC wall efficiently. A mock-up test for a staircase using the PC Double wall was performed to verify the constructability and integrity of the PC walls. The test result verified that joint deformation and cracking did not occur as showing good constructability.
